Les données indiquent que,Plus de 901 millions d'internautes accèdent à des sites web via des appareils mobiles.L'adaptation mobile devient alors absolument cruciale. J'ai un ami qui tient une boutique de vêtements ; auparavant, leur site web officiel était uniquement conçu pour les ordinateurs de bureau, mais ils ont ensuite découvert...60%Nos clients accèdent principalement à notre site via des appareils mobiles. Nous sommes rapidement passés à un design réactif, permettant aux pages d'ajuster automatiquement leur mise en page pour les téléphones et les tablettes. En conséquence, le trafic des clients a considérablement augmenté..

Chronologie d'AvadaEn tant qu'élément central illustrant l'évolution historique des sites Web d'entreprise, sa mise en œuvre réactive a un impact direct sur l'expérience de navigation de plus de 681 millions d'utilisateurs mobiles. L'adoption d'une approche de conception réactive axée sur le mobile garantit que le site Web bénéficie du code le plus rationalisé et le plus efficace sur les appareils mobiles, avec une moyenne deRéduire le chargement inutile des styles de 421 TP3Tet peut réduire les volumes de transfert d'images mobiles de 651 To, améliorant ainsi considérablement les vitesses de chargement et l'expérience utilisateur..
I. La philosophie fondamentale de conception du « mobile first »
Avada Timeline utilise une stratégie de conception axée sur le mobile. Cette philosophie de conception imprègne tous les aspects, de la structure du code à la présentation visuelle.
Les styles de base sont définis en prenant comme point de départ les appareils mobiles. TousCSSLes styles sont initialement écrits pour les appareils à petit écran, puis améliorés pour les écrans plus grands via des requêtes multimédias. Cette approche garantit que les appareils mobiles reçoivent le code le plus rationalisé et le plus efficace possible, réduisant ainsi le chargement inutile de styles de 421 kilo-octets en moyenne.

L'optimisation de l'interaction tactile améliore l'expérience d'utilisation mobile. La taille minimale des cibles tactiles entre les nœuds de la chronologie est fixée à 44 × 44 pixels, conformément aux normes d'accessibilité WCAG 2.1. La prise en charge des gestes de balayage permet aux utilisateurs de naviguer naturellement dans le contenu de la chronologie sur les appareils mobiles, ce qui améliore de 351 % la fluidité opérationnelle par rapport aux méthodes traditionnelles basées sur les clics.
II. La fonction principale de la disposition CSS Grid
Le composant Timeline utilise le système de mise en page CSS Grid pour réaliser des compositions bidimensionnelles complexes. Cette fonctionnalité CSS moderne offre un contrôle sans précédent sur la mise en page.
Le conteneur de grille définit la structure globale de la chronologie.colonnes du modèle de grilleLes attributs établissent le cadre fondamental de la chronologie et de la zone de contenu, tandis que `grid-template-rows` régit l'espacement vertical entre chaque nœud. Ces configurations garantissent que la chronologie conserve un alignement visuel parfait sur les écrans d'ordinateur.

La dénomination des zones de grille améliore la maintenabilité du code. En attribuant des noms sémantiques aux chronologies, icônes, dates et contenus via la propriété `grid-area`, CSS établit une correspondance claire avec la structure HTML. Cette pratique augmente l'efficacité de la maintenance ultérieure de 60%, ce qui s'avère particulièrement utile dans les environnements de travail collaboratif.
III. Adaptation intelligente du système de points de rupture
Le système de points de rupture d'Avada Timeline est basé sur les exigences en matière de contenu plutôt que sur les dimensions fixes des appareils. Cette approche permet d'obtenir un design réactif véritablement axé sur le contenu.
Les points de rupture principaux sont définis à deux seuils clés : 768 px et 1024 px. En dessous de 768 px, la mise en page verticale mobile est appliquée ; entre 768 px et 1024 px, la mise en page optimisée pour les tablettes est activée ; au-dessus de 1024 px, l'expérience complète de la chronologie sur ordinateur de bureau est affichée. Cette configuration couvre 99,21 % des plages de fenêtres d'affichage des appareils.

Le principe de l'amélioration progressive guide l'affichage fonctionnel à travers différents points de rupture. Les appareils mobiles donnent la priorité au contenu essentiel et aux chronologies clés, les tablettes ajoutent des informations supplémentaires et des animations de transition, tandis que les écrans d'ordinateur de bureau présentent la chronologie complète avec toutes les fonctionnalités interactives. Cette stratégie garantit que le contenu essentiel reste accessible sur tous les appareils.
IV. Stratégie de restructuration de la mise en page mobile
La disposition de la chronologie sur les appareils à petit écran a été entièrement repensée. Une disposition à défilement vertical remplace la chronologie horizontale, optimisant ainsi le modèle d'interaction naturel pour les appareils mobiles.
La disposition verticale améliore la lisibilité sur mobile. Les nœuds de la chronologie passent à un design de carte pleine largeur, la chronologie étant simplifiée en une ligne de connexion à gauche et les informations de date étant affichées de manière proéminente en haut de chaque carte. Cette disposition améliore l'efficacité de la lecture sur mobile de 55% et accélère la recherche d'informations de 40%.

Les modèles d'interaction tactiles améliorent l'expérience mobile. Appuyez sur les nœuds de la chronologie pour afficher les détails en douceur, plutôt que de vous fier aux effets de survol de type bureau. Le défilement inertiel et le transfert d'élan rendent la navigation dans les contenus longs facile et naturelle, ce qui correspond aux attentes des utilisateurs mobiles.
V. Détails techniques de l'optimisation des performances
conception réactiveLes considérations relatives aux performances sont intégrées tout au long du processus de développement. Le fractionnement du code et le chargement conditionnel garantissent que chaque appareil ne reçoit que les ressources nécessaires.
La gestion réactive des images fait appel à des techniques modernes. L'attribut srcset fournit des images à différentes résolutions en fonction du rapport pixel de l'appareil et des dimensions de la fenêtre d'affichage, tandis que l'attribut sizes contrôle avec précision les dimensions d'affichage à différents points de rupture. Ces optimisations réduisent le volume de transfert d'images mobiles de 651 To.

Le chargement à la demande CSS évite le gaspillage de ressources. En exploitant les points d'arrêt des requêtes multimédias, il garantit que chaque appareil ne télécharge que les règles de style applicables. Les appareils mobiles ne reçoivent pas les animations complexes et les styles de mise en page destinés aux ordinateurs de bureau, ce qui permet d'économiser la précieuse bande passante réseau et la puissance de traitement.
VI. Pratique d'analyse des outils de développement
Les outils de développement des navigateurs modernes offrent des fonctionnalités avancées d'analyse de la mise en page. Ces outils aident les développeurs à comprendre et à déboguer les comportements réactifs complexes.
L'inspecteur de grille permet de visualiser les dispositions de la timeline. L'activation de la fonction d'affichage de la grille superposée du navigateur permet de voir clairement les lignes de la grille, les dimensions des pistes et la répartition des zones. Cette fonctionnalité simplifie considérablement le processus de débogage de la disposition, réduisant le temps de dépannage de 45 minutes en moyenne à seulement 10 minutes.
Le mode Appareil simule des environnements de test réels. L'émulateur d'appareil des outils de développement fournit des dimensions précises de la fenêtre d'affichage, les ratios de pixels de l'appareil et une simulation des événements tactiles. Associé à des capacités de limitation du réseau, il permet de détecter et de résoudre les problèmes de performances pendant la phase de développement.

La mise en œuvre réactive d'Avada Timeline illustre les meilleures pratiques en matière de développement web moderne. De sa philosophie de conception axée sur le mobile à son contrôle précis de la mise en page via CSS Grid, en passant par son système intelligent de points d'arrêt et ses techniques d'optimisation des performances, chaque aspect reflète une réflexion approfondie sur les expériences multi-appareils. Cette architecture technique garantit non seulement un affichage impeccable sur les appareils actuels, mais jette également des bases solides pour les appareils futurs et les modèles d'interaction émergents.
Lien vers cet article :https://www.361sale.com/fr/81400/L'article est protégé par le droit d'auteur et doit être reproduit avec mention.

























![Emoji[wozuimei]-Photonflux.com | Service professionnel de réparation de WordPress, dans le monde entier, réponse rapide](https://www.361sale.com/wp-content/themes/zibll/img/smilies/wozuimei.gif)
![Émoticône [baoquan] - Photon Wave Network | Services professionnels de réparation WordPress, couverture mondiale, réponse rapide](https://www.361sale.com/wp-content/themes/zibll/img/smilies/baoquan.gif)

Pas de commentaires